Masai Ujiri and the Raptors are in a good place. Luxurious, really

The Toronto Raptors can’t wait to keep waiting, and it’s not a bad place to be. As training camp begins, people will watch to see whether Toronto is deeper, whether Fred VanVleet is more durable, and which Raptors made the biggest leaps. This is a team with continuity from last season, and through the summer. They could be good.

And still, this is a team waiting for its future to come, whatever it is. That’s not a bad thing; it’s actually a bit of a magic trick. The Raptors aren’t a title contender, but this is a 48-win team that should be better this year while also running a 24/7 development program.
